Output d312df890fff336a4ebf26338a70e1bcdaca10830990a50b048bf23aae0fc2aa:0

value
30770341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f076f3b18e9e640e57181ba583240b244ae48bfd OP_EQUAL
address
3PcUbWQrwi5mf6526XrZpPQ2FmBZ7kbk9k
transaction
d312df890fff336a4ebf26338a70e1bcdaca10830990a50b048bf23aae0fc2aa
spent
true